Bilingual Certification Operations Assistant
Catholic Charities of the Archdiocese of New YorkBilingual Certification Operations Assistant at CCOF. Responsibilities include client support, data management, and communication in English and Spanish.
About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Work daily in a proprietary database to complete an array of data entry tasks for a variety of client submissions, ensuring that database records are accurate, consistent, and current.
- Support CCOF clients by providing high-quality customer service in both Spanish and English via phone and email correspondence regarding general questions and client online portal assistance.
- Independently manage workload to ensure timely completion of tasks to meet deadlines and support team goals. Complete quality and quantity of work on par with other Certification Operations Assistants of similar tenure.
- Conduct peer-to-peer training and follow-up for new team members to ensure that they are proficient in their responsibilities and work efficiently and effectively to contribute to the team's success.
- Work daily in a shared email inbox to upload client submissions into the database, process them, and assign workload to Certification staff, including rush and expedited requests (high priority submissions with short turnaround timelines). Complete data entry for various client updates such as transitional/organic parcel status changes, parcel and product additions, renewals, surrenders, and other updates.
- Process new client applications including completing data entry, processing payments, and following up with applicants.
- Respond to general inquiries from CCOF clients in both Spanish and English and provide excellent customer service for incoming phone calls and email inquiries. Accept and transfer calls to appropriate staff in a timely and courteous manner.
- Assist the Front Desk, Accounting, New Applicant Support, and Certification staff by answering questions regarding client submissions and communications.
- Process inspection report documents and assign inspection reports for review.
- Process Export Certificate and NOP Import Certificate requests and answer client questions.
- Support team workload by completing special projects, updating work instructions, and demonstrating initiative to improve administrative system efficiencies.
- Attend and contribute to biweekly Certification Operations Team meetings and recurring staff meetings. Monitor internal communications to maintain knowledge of current topics, updates, and announcements.
- Provide Spanish translations for team members and team resources (e.g., email templates and signatures, Certification Operations internal procedures, contextual explanations, and refine email drafts following initial machine translation). Review translated materials to ensure accuracy, appropriate tone, and technical correctness. Support special projects and participate in Spanish Services meetings as needed.
